Using whole genome sequence data to study genomic diversity and develop molecular barcodes to profile Plasmodium malaria parasites
2018-01-01
Abstract excerpt
Malaria is a major threat to human health, causing over 300 million clinical cases and approximately ~500,000 deaths per year. Countries attempting malaria elimination are increasingly concerned with identifying pockets of transmission and outbreaks arising from imported cases, and there is a need to establish molecular barcodes for implementation in the field.
